When it comes to the writing system during Egyptian civilization, the Egyptians used papyrus made from reeds for writing purposes. They were not vulnerable to attack as Sumerians as they led lives that prepared them for the afterlife. The Egyptians believed in afterlife and had elaborate funerary practices to ensure the survival of their souls after death. One of the main differences between the Sumerians and the Egyptians in their ways of life is their understanding of the phenomenon of death and their conception of life after death. It is interesting to note that the pharaoh, the king of Egypt was looked upon as a living god by the Egyptians. They believed in rituals and offerings to god, appealing for their help. When it comes to gods, Egyptians worshipped an innumerable number of gods and goddesses who were believed to be present in, and in control of the nature. They used clay tablets for writing purposes.

The system of writing employed by the Sumerians was called by the name cuneiform. It is to be known that the Sumerians were the first ever well-known civilization to develop a system of writing that was progressed from a proto writing of mid 4000BC. The Sumerians did not worship their king as a god. One of the meanings of ‘Sumer’ is ‘land of the civilized lords.’ The deities worshipped by the Sumerians were the god of heaven, the god of air, the god of water and the goddess of earth. This area occupied by the Sumerians is the present day Iraq. They lived on the plains of Tigris and Euphrates, known as southern Mesopotamia, around 5000 BC.
